MCP Go Server connects AI assistants like Claude directly to the Go runtime. It acts as a bridge, giving your AI the necessary tools to execute, manage, and optimize Go-based development workflows efficiently.
Overview

What is Golang Mcp Server?

Golang Mcp Server is a tool that connects AI assistants like Claude directly to the Go runtime, acting as a bridge to enhance Go-based development workflows.

How to use Golang Mcp Server?

To use the Golang Mcp Server, set up the server with the provided command and configure it to manage your Go development tasks through the AI assistant.

Key features of Golang Mcp Server?

  • 22 Comprehensive Tools: Includes code execution, Go operations, optimization, server management, and package documentation.
  • Cross-Platform Support: Works on Linux, macOS, and Windows.
  • Guided Prompts: Step-by-step guides for various Go development tasks.

Use cases of Golang Mcp Server?

  1. Automating Go project setups and testing.
  2. Optimizing Go code performance through profiling and benchmarking.
  3. Managing long-running Go servers efficiently.

Server Config

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"mcp-go": {
      "command": "/usr/local/bin/mcp-go",
      "args": [],
      "env": {
        "DISABLE_NOTIFICATIONS": "true"
      }
    }
  }
}
